Overview
The call DIGITAL-JU under the Chips for Europe Initiative and the Digital Europe Programme funds PCB level demonstrators of AI chip prototypes designed by EU fabless companies and integrated with system partners. The topic budget is €10,000,000 for 2026 with an expected ten grants and individual EU contributions between €500,000 and €1,000,000. Selected demonstrators will be validated on a common EU evaluation platform and shortlisted solutions may receive an AI Compute Excellence label and progress to rack level development. Single stage full proposals must be submitted via the EU Funding and Tenders Portal by 23 September 2026 and enquiries can be sent to Calls@chips-ju.europa.eu.

Expected outcomes and purpose
This topic aims to fund demonstrators of working AI chip prototypes designed by European fabless companies and integrated with system partners, with validation performed on a common EU evaluation platform. The expected outcomes are: functional PCB-level AI chip demonstrators by EU fabless companies physically integrated with system partners; comparative validation evidence on key performance indicators via a common EU evaluation platform provided by the Topic X.B consortium; and a shortlist of European AI chip solutions awarded the AI Compute Excellence label and qualified to proceed to full rack development under Topic X.A2.

Budget categories, funding rules and cost eligibility
Grant form:budget-based action grant under the DEP MGA. Eligible cost categories follow the DEP MGA: personnel, subcontracting, purchases (travel, equipment, other goods and services), other costs (financial support to third parties if allowed), and indirect costs reimbursed at a flat-rate (7% of eligible direct costs A-D except volunteers and exempted categories). Equipment treatment follows DEP MGA rules (depreciation principle is default; call may specify exceptions). VAT rules and country restrictions apply as per the MGA and call conditions. Co-funding: the call is co-funded with national funding authorities; applicants should consult the Guide for Applicants and national co-funding rules in the Chips JU call page. Maximum grant amounts and funding rates per beneficiary will be specified in Annex 2 and possibly Annex 2e where complex funding rates apply.

Consortium composition and partners
Recommended consortium composition:a lead beneficiary (typically the fabless company designing the AI chip), at least one system partner responsible for physical integration and system-level validation, and optional partners: hardware test labs, research institutes or universities (for algorithm/system co-design, benchmarking), and the Topic X.B consortium (evaluation platform) as external validation provider. Roles and responsibilities should be clearly defined in Annex 1 of the application form and the consortium agreement. Ownership Control Declaration completion is required for all consortium members to assess participation restrictions.
Key requirements and technical expectations
Technical expectations include delivery of functional AI chip prototypes at PCB level, demonstrable integration with system partners (power, cooling, networking and software stack as relevant), validation on common EU evaluation platform with comparative KPI evidence, readiness for subsequent rack-level development for shortlisted solutions, and compliance with security and data protection obligations in DEP MGA and Chips JU rules. Applicants must include clear test plans, KPI definitions and benchmarking methodology aligned with the Topic X.B evaluation platform.
How the evaluation and validation chain connects to next phases
Demonstrators validated on the Topic X.B evaluation platform will be compared on KPIs; a shortlist will receive the AI Compute Excellence label indicating qualification to proceed to Topic X.A2 for full rack development. The evaluation platform provides comparative evidence to inform selection for scaling and integration into EU compute infrastructure.

Security, ownership and participation restrictions
This call is subject to participation restrictions aimed at protecting European digital infrastructures, communications and information systems and related supply chains. Applicants must submit Ownership Control Declarations for each consortium member to allow ownership and control assessments. The OCD forms are provided and may be merged into a single PDF for the proposal upload or submitted individually in case of sensitive content. Failure to provide required OCD documentation may render a proposal ineligible.
